Abstract

A toilet includes a toilet bowl assembly having a toilet bowl and a trapway extending from the bottom of the toilet bowl to a sewage line. The toilet bowl has a rim channel provided along an upper perimeter portion thereof. In this toilet, the flush water flows through the rim channel in a path which is asymmetric and unidirectional along the entire perimeter portion thereof. The rim channel includes a plurality of rim openings distributed evenly along the perimeter of the rim channel. Flush water passing through the plurality of rim openings pre-wets the entire perimeter of the toilet bowl. The rim channel further includes a pair of water discharge slots which directs water directly into the toilet bowl in two powerful streams. The flush valve allowing passage of water from the water tank to the toilet bowl assembly is in the form of a valve inlet having a radiused port to generate greater energy throughput of the flush water.

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A water closet comprising: 
 a toilet bowl assembly having a toilet bowl and a trapway extending from the bottom of the toilet bowl to a sewage line, the toilet bowl having a rim channel along an upper perimetral portion thereof;    a water tank positioned over the toilet bowl assembly which contains water that is used to initiate the siphoning from the toilet bowl to the sewage line and refills the toilet bowl with fresh flush water after each flush operation; and    wherein the flush water flows through the rim channel of the toilet bowl assembly in a flow path which is asymmetric and unidirectional.    
     
     
         2 . The water closet of  claim 1  wherein said rim part has a plurality of rim openings distributed evenly along the perimeter of the rim channel.  
     
     
         3 . The water closet of  claim 2  wherein each of said rim openings has a diameter approximately {fraction (7/32)}″.  
     
     
         4 . The water closet of  claim 2  wherein flush water passing through said plurality of rim openings pre-wets the entire perimeter of the toilet bowl.  
     
     
         5 . The water closet of  claim 1  wherein said trapway has a diameter of up to approximately 2.5″ throughout its entire length.  
     
     
         6 . The water closet of  claim 1  wherein the flush water is evacuated from the toilet bowl in approximately 2.5 seconds.  
     
     
         7 . The water closet of  claim 1  and further including a water path connector for directing flush water from said water tank into said toilet bowl.  
     
     
         8 . The water closet of  claim 7  wherein said water path connector includes a discharge port bridging water flow between said water tank and said toilet bowl.  
     
     
         9 . The water closet of  claim 8  wherein said water tank has a flush valve formed of a valve inlet having a radiused port.  
     
     
         10 . The water closet of  claim 1  wherein said rim channel includes a pair of water discharge slots which discharge flush water directly into said toilet bowl in two water streams which create a strong vortex action.
